    Who is Dr. Chiu, Ophthalmologist in Santa Fe, NM?

    Dr. Mark Chiu, MD is an Ophthalmologist, who primarily practices in Santa Fe, NM with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Ophthalmology. Dr. Chiu graduated from University of Texas Southwestern Medical School, Dallas and completed his residency at Wills Eye Hosp, Ophthalmology; Jackson Mem Hosp/Jackson Hlth, Ophthalmology; Presbyterian Hosp, Internal Medicine. Dr. Chiu is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Chiu’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are, Aetna and other major insurance plans.     Dr. Chiu is a Ophthalmologist near Santa Fe, NM. An ophthalmologist possesses the knowledge and professional skills required to deliver comprehensive eye and vision care. These medical doctors are trained to diagnose, monitor, and treat all ocular and visual disorders, whether through medical or surgical interventions. Their expertise encompasses a wide range of issues affecting the eye and its structures, including the eyelids, orbit, and visual pathways.     Is this Dr. Mark Chiu aff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Chiu is affiliated with Presbyterian Hospital - Albuquerque, NM which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
